"OPRAH'S NEXT CHAPTER" RIHANNA INTERVIEW RANKS #1 IN KEY WOMEN DEMOS IN TIME PERIOD AND #2 IN ALL OF PRIMETIME AMONG ALL AD-SUPPORTED CABLE DELIVERING 2.5 MILLION VIEWERS

Interview Scores Second Highest Telecast in OWN History

New Original Series "Lovetown" Launches As Second Highest Network Premiere Ever

OWN Continues Ratings Momentum with 31 Consecutive Weeks of Year- Over-Year Growth and is on Track for Third Consecutive Quarter of Growth

Los Angeles - "Oprah's Next Chapter" featuring Oprah Winfrey's interview with music phenonenon Rihanna (Sunday, August 19 from 9-10 p.m. ET/PT) ranked #1 in its time period across the keyfemale demos among all ad-supported cable networks, ranked #2 in all of primetime overall among ad-supported cable, and was #1 in its time period in W18-49 among all broadcast and ad-supported cable (2.43 W25-54, 2.49 W18-49, 2.5 million total viewers). The episode posted triple digit growth across the key demos versus year ago numbers (+350% W25-54, +199% total viewers).

Sunday's episode marked OWN's second highest rated telecast in network history. The series also topped all key African American demos in its time period on all of broadcast and ad-supported cable (11.37 AA W25-54; 11.47 AA W18-49; 11.5 HH; 1.65 million total viewers).

Following "Oprah's Next Chapter", the series premiere of new original series "Lovetown, USA" (10-11 p.m. ET/PT) featuring a unique social experiment on love, marking the network's second highest series premiere ever in the key demo with a .79 W25-54 rating, behind only "Oprah's Next Chapter" (Steven Tyler on Jan 1, 2012; 1.07 W25-54) and tying "Ask Oprah's All Stars" (Jan. 2, 2011; .79 W25-54). The premiere episode was up triple digits versus year ago numbers in the key female demo (+108% W25-54).

Additionally, OWN has notched its 31st consecutive week of total day growth across all key demos versus year ago numbers (+67% W25-54, +51% total viewers) and continues to post double-digit ratings growth in primetime and total day. The network is on track to deliver its third consecutive quarter of growth, with the week of August 13 posting the second highest week in primetime ever (.37 W25-54) and tying the highest rating week ever in total day (.20 W25-54).

OWN remains up double digits in both primetime and total day for the year, with primetime posting +15% in both W25-54 and total viewers, posting +36% W25-54 and +33% total viewers versus year ago numbers.

About "Lovetown" (Sundays at 10 p.m.)

After a nationwide search, Oprah Winfrey named Kingsland, Georgia to be "Lovetown, USA." Winfrey traveled to Georgia and launched the first of its kind social experiment, where she called the community to action at a "love rally" and challenged everyone to "open their arms and hearts to the possibilities of all kinds of love." Two experienced relationship coaches, Paul Carrick Brunson and Kailen Rosenberg, have the daunting task of transforming Kingsland in 30 short days. The coaches will attempt to mend relationships of embattled friends and lovers, and find true love for singles with people living in their own back yard. Involving everyone from the mayor to grade school students, this social experiment will examine the affects love, grace, kindness and forgiveness can have on an entire community. About OWN: Oprah Winfrey Network

A joint venture between Harpo, Inc. and Discovery Communications, OWN: Oprah Winfrey Network is a multi-platform media company designed to entertain, inform and inspire people to live their best lives. OWN debuted on January 1, 2011, in approximately 80 million homes on what was the Discovery Health Channel. The venture also includes the award-winning digital platform, Oprah.com. OWN: Oprah Winfrey Network is currently available in approximately 67% of homes in the United States and 80% of cable homes.
